sjradio 0 Report post Posted January 3, 2009 Saw this in the Chicago Daily Herald leading up to the Winter Classic. http://www.dailyherald.com/story/?id=261657&src=149 Not Winging it: Hawks coach Joel Quenneville is 19-50-10 lifetime coaching against the Red Wings, with Tuesday's loss the 11th straight, including the sweep of his Avalanche in the playoffs last spring. Quenneville has coached in four playoff series against Detroit and lost them all. Make that 19-51-10. That is a .300 winning percentage for Q against the Wings while with the Blues, Avalanche, and now with the Hawks. Share this post Link to post Share on other sites

Regular season record vs the Wings 12-35-10 (OTLs in L column). 129GF 194GA for a 2.26GFA and a 3.40GAA Postseason record vs the Red Wings 5-16. 45GF and 71GA for a 2.14GFA and a 3.40GAA Combined record vs the Wings. 17-51-10. 174GF and 265GA for a 2.23GFA and a 3.40GAA. Q's lone regular season shutout vs the Wings was a 0-0 tie in '00. His regular season teams have been shut out 7 times by the Wings. Playoffs is another matter as it's 2 whitewashes both ways. The Blues skunked us twice in '97 and we skunked them twice in '02. Q's teams scored 4+ 15 times in the 78 meetings. The Wings dumped 4+ on Q 40 times, so just over half the games. Q's worst years are '03 and '08. '03 he went 0-5 getting outscored 10-26 and in '08 going 0-8 getting outscored 11-32.
